MANILA, Philippines - The House of Representatives has started its deliberations on the P881 billion budget of the Department of Public Works and Highways amid increasing scrutiny of the anomalous flood control projects hounding the agency.

Appropriations Committee Chairman and Nueva Ecija Rep. Mikaela Suansing vowed for a comprehensive review of the DPWH's budget and explained that she would like to tie in flood control projects using Project NOAH (National Operational Assessment of Hazards) of the University of the Philippines Resilience Institute.
